Buy Local Fair scheduled for May 22 in Louisville

More than 8,000 people attended last year

LOUISVILLE, Ky. (APRIL 28, 2016) — The Louisville Independent Business Alliance (LIBA) will host the Buy Local Fair from noon to 6 p.m. on May 22 at Louisville Water Tower Park. Admission is free. Parking is $5 per vehicle. Last year more than 8,000 people attended the fair.

This year’s fair will include more than 200 booths from local businesses, artists and craftspeople, community organizations, and farmers. Also available will be a craft beer tent, 25 food and drink vendors, a cooking competition, aerial circus, silent auction and children’s activities.

The cooking competition will feature a showdown between Shawn Ward of Ward 426 and Patrick Roney of Harvest. The chefs will be given a basket of mystery ingredients and will have 30 minutes to create a dish for a panel of judges.
